Our Impact

For over a decade, Teach For Armenia has been building a movement of teacher-leaders committed to educational equity and national renewal.

30,000+

Students reached every year

550+

Alumni leaders

10

Regions served

70%

Alumni remain in education or public service

Teacher-Leader Development

Our two-year program transforms talented graduates into skilled, purposeful leaders who carry their impact far beyond the classroom.

Rigorous Pedagogical Training

Intensive pre-service and ongoing professional development grounded in evidence-based teaching methods.

Change-Based Learning Methodology

A proprietary approach where students don’t just learn about problems, they learn to solve them in their own communities.

Leadership Under Pressure

Real-world experience navigating complex stakeholder environments, resource constraints, and systemic challenges.

Coaching & Mentorship

Continuous support from experienced educators and leadership coaches throughout the two-year program.

Alumni Impact

70%

of alumni remain in education, public service, or social impact

Our alumni become principals, NGO leaders, policy advisors, founders, and public servants—carrying classroom-tested leadership into the institutions Armenia relies on.

Alumni Impact
  • Education leadership and school administration
  • Government and public policy
  • NGOs and international organizations
  • Technology, innovation, and entrepreneurship
  • Consulting, finance, and social enterprise
